#!/bin/sh

set -ex

rm /etc/nginx/sites-enabled/default
cp /usr/share/doc/searx/examples/nginx/sites-available/searx /etc/nginx/sites-available
ln -s ../sites-available/searx /etc/nginx/sites-enabled/searx
cp /usr/share/doc/searx/examples/uwsgi/apps-available/searx.ini /etc/uwsgi/apps-available
ln -s ../apps-available/searx.ini /etc/uwsgi/apps-enabled/searx.ini
mkdir /etc/searx
cp /usr/share/doc/searx/examples/settings.yml /etc/searx/settings.yml
sed -i -e "s/ultrasecretkey/$(openssl rand -hex 16)/g" /etc/searx/settings.yml
systemctl restart nginx
systemctl restart uwsgi
sleep 5
systemctl status nginx
systemctl status uwsgi
cat /var/log/uwsgi/app/searx.log
curl localhost
curl localhost | grep '<input type="search".* name="q"'
